Miniature casts of goddess Saraswati are painted by an artist at his workshop ahead of the Saraswati Puja in late winter. These idols will be immersed in water bodies after the necessary rituals of welcoming spring the Hindu way. A multitude of bright colours is used to make the goddess's idols look life like.
